A/c Maintenance
Regular maintenance keeps your a/c system running effectively. Our professional HVAC specialists perform thorough maintenance services that include:
- Cleaning or changing air filters
- Examining refrigerant levels
- Cleaning condenser and evaporator coils
- Examining and cleaning drain lines
- Inspecting electrical connections
- Lubing moving parts
- Testing thermostat operation
- Verifying correct airflow

Heating System Maintenance
Regular maintenance avoids numerous he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C contractors perform extensive upkeep services that consist of:
- Inspecting heat exchangers for fractures
- Examining combustion performance
- Testing safety controls
- Cleaning up or replacing filters
- Examining electrical connections
- Oiling moving parts
- Cleaning up burners and changing the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Restricted air flow makes your system work more difficult and minimizes convenience. Our HVAC professionals recognize air flow issues, whether caused by duct problems, dirty filters, or fan issues.
- Irregular Heating or Cooling
If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ation issues, or an improperly sized system. Our expert HVAC professionals can detect these problems and suggest options.
- Brief Cycling
When your system turns on and off often, it wastes energy and wears components much faster. Our HVAC specialists can figure out whether the issue stems from a clogged fil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more severe.
- High Energy Bills
Abrupt increases in energy costs often indicate H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ists perform energy performance assessments to identify the cause and suggest enhancements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ems must help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C specialists can advise options to improve comfort and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
Often what looks like a system failure is really a thermostat problem. Our HVAC professionals can fix or replace thermostats and help you update to programmable or wise models for much better comfort control and energy savings.
